Output 74b37fec39f254054de239dd12b270dedf6af6330333dc578b612c8d27a8e8c0:2

value
12500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10f50a948adf903228182e36d3214826232bd522 OP_EQUAL
address
33EgHPAtZewhFMyN5T528w7HWeDyHTqHPw
transaction
74b37fec39f254054de239dd12b270dedf6af6330333dc578b612c8d27a8e8c0
spent
true